Cases of Effective Grocery Packaging Innovations
Since consumers are increasingly focused on sustainability and ease of use, grocery packaging has evolved to meet these demands with numerous groundbreaking developments. A prime illustration of this is the adoption of biodegradable packaging options, which decompose naturally, decreasing the burden on landfills. Businesses such as FreshDirect have embraced eco-friendly bags designed to attract sustainability-minded customers.
In addition, reusable containers have gained traction, as organizations like Loop deliver a refill-and-return program, reducing single-use plastic waste. Smart packaging technologies, utilizing QR codes or NFC technology, elevate the customer experience by supplying in-depth product data and encouraging sustainable recycling habits.
Additionally, vacuum-sealing technology extends product freshness, reducing food waste while ensuring freshness. Industry leaders such as Blue Apron utilize this method to deliver ingredients efficiently. These advancements not only meet consumer demands but also support sustainability objectives, showcasing the grocery industry's commitment to responsible packaging solutions within a growing digital marketplace.

What Kinds of Products Are Most Suitable for Grocery Delivery?
Perishable items including fruits, vegetables, meats, and dairy products are best suited for home grocery delivery. In addition, non-perishable products like frozen foods, canned goods, and dry staples also perform well, guaranteeing a comprehensive variety for shoppers.
How Do Grocery Delivery Companies Deal With Perishable Items?
Grocery delivery services utilize specialized insulated packaging and climate-controlled conditions to maintain the freshness of perishable items. They focus on timely delivery and frequently use refrigerated vehicles to guarantee ideal conditions until products reach the customer.
What Are Typical Delivery Timeframes for Grocery Orders?
Common delivery timeframes for grocery orders generally span one to two hours for express options, while standard deliveries may take up to 24 hours. Shoppers frequently choose their desired delivery windows at checkout for added convenience.
Are There Fees Associated With Grocery Delivery Services?
Indeed, online grocery services frequently charge fees such as minimum order fees, delivery charges, or service costs. Such charges vary depending on the service and are often influenced by considerations including order size and delivery location.
